Extrauterine growth restriction in very‐low‐birthweight infants
1 Dec 2004
Abstract excerpt
UNLABELLED: Postnatal growth failure of very-low-birthweight (VLBW) infants may result from a complex interaction of genetic and environmental factors, including inadequate nutrition, morbidities affecting nutrient requirements, endocrine abnormalities and treatments.
